To get a seat in IIIT, you need to first have cleared the JEE Main cutoff as per your category. After clearing the cutoff you have to attend the JoSAA counselling through which admissions will be done. In the counselling you will get know which colleges and branches are you getting as per your JEE Main score. If anyhow you don't get a seat through JoSAA counselling then you can apply for CSAB counselling through which also you can a seat in IIIT. The CSAB counselling will begin after JoSAA ends. In CSAB there is a Special Round counselling through which JEE Main qualified candidates are given admission to NITs,IIITs and GFTIs.
